For £42.38 ex‑VAT, the Epson T0715 DURABrite Ultra multipack is one of those “buy it when you need it” options rather than a bargain bin special. The upside is the DURABrite Ultra reputation: solid text, decent colour for day-to-day business printing, and generally good resistance to smudging/handling compared with cheaper dye inks. If you’re printing documents that get handled a lot (forms, internal packs, client handouts), it’s a sensible choice—especially if your printer is one of the models that’s meant to run these inks reliably.
That said, I wouldn’t buy this unless you know your usage pattern. Multipacks make sense when you’re actually going to use all colours soon; if your printing is mostly black-and-white, you’ll usually get better value by replacing only what you’re running out of, not all four at once. Also, if you need ultra-consistent branding colour or photo-style output, inkjet inks in general won’t beat higher-end systems—so for occasional “good enough” office output, this is fine; for heavy creative colour work, look elsewhere. If your current cost-per-page checks out against your print volume, then yes—this is a practical, low-drama ink choice for typical UK office use.
